[quote=Anonymous]I was born in the 1960s. My parents were middle class in another country. I grew up in an incredibly happy home and there was an abundance of good home made food all the time. We did not go to eat in restaurants because going to eat in restaurants was not common practice. However, we belonged to organizations (church, military, school) etc that usually organized huge events with many food stalls. My father was also a very social man who was always planning road trips and picnics for his family and friends. And so we were always going for an adventure. He would hire cooks and servers and they would reach the scenic spots before we did and usually have a large campfire going. My mom has always been a wonderful cook, and our house was a place where people dropped by and remained for meals. I grew up eating wonderful meals and I am now married to a man who also is a foodie and we are constantly cooking and hosting. [/quote]
